24AA256T-E/MNY Frequently Asked Questions (FAQ)
-
The 24AA256T-E/MNY has a minimum of 1 million write cycles, but the actual number of write cycles may vary depending on the application and usage.
-
To ensure data integrity, use the 24AA256T-E/MNY's built-in power-on reset (POR) and brown-out detection (BOD) features. Additionally, implement a robust power-down sequence and consider using a voltage supervisor to monitor the power supply.
-
The recommended operating voltage range for the 24AA256T-E/MNY is 2.5V to 5.5V. Operating outside this range may affect the device's performance and reliability.
-
The 24AA256T-E/MNY uses a page-based write architecture. To write data, divide the data into pages (typically 64 bytes) and perform a page write operation. For larger data sets, use block writes, which are composed of multiple page writes.
